In der Indian River Lagoon machen wir uns auf den Weg zur Seekuh-Box, um einen Blick auf eines der freundlichsten Meeressäugetiere der Erde zu werfen. Manchmal tauchen sie direkt neben dir auf und du kannst sie tatsächlich kratzen! Nachdem wir mit der Seekuh rumgehangen haben, machen wir uns auf die Suche nach Delfinen, die den ganzen Tag über aktiv nach ihrem Futter suchen. Es ist nicht ungewöhnlich, dass sie aus dem Wasser schießen und direkt vor uns in der Luft Fische fangen. Nachdem wir Zeit mit einigen fantastischen Wildtieren verbracht haben, werden wir uns auf den weltberühmten Sonnenuntergang in Florida einlassen. - Rollstuhlgerechter Zugang
- Nicht empfohlen für Reisende mit Wirbelsäulenverletzungen
- Nicht empfohlen für Schwangere
- Nicht empfohlen für Reisende mit Herz-Kreislauf-Schwäche
- Für alle Fitnesslevel geeignet
- Das maximale Gewicht eines einzelnen Passagiers beträgt 300 Pfund für diese Aktivität.
